The CO2 emissions from manufacture (the so-called embodied carbon) of end-user Information and Communications Technology (ICT) devices makes up the majority of their carbon footprint over the typical current useful life of such devices. To achieve sustainable ICT, in addition to reducing run time energy consumption, it is therefore essential to extend the active life, ideally to several decades. The PhD project aim to develop a novel adaptive embedded hardware system,  equipped with a low-level hardware monitoring system together with a multi-level self-healing and diagnostics capabilities for adaptation of embedded software and hardware during run-time. The vision of this project is to demonstrate the possibility of extending the lifetime of IoT devices from several years to decades through a combination of novel hardware/software co-design approach and machine learning based self-healing techniques. This project will not only be providing the ability to reliably operate the embedded systems in complex practical environment with cost-effective manner, but also accurately assess the degradation of any given device, enabling the repurposing of devices with reduced capabilities for new tasks.
